一、引言
网站性能优化是提升用户体验、提高搜索引擎排名和降低服务器负载的重要手段。一个优化良好的网站不仅能够提供快速响应的服务,还能增强用户对品牌的信任。以下是一份详细的网站性能优化工作方案。
二、性能优化目标
1、提高页面加载速度:确保页面在3秒内完成加载。
2、优化用户体验:确保网站在不同设备和浏览器上的兼容性。
3、降低服务器负载:减少服务器资源消耗,提高服务器稳定性。
4、提高搜索引擎排名:通过优化提升网站在搜索引擎中的可见度。
三、性能优化策略
1、代码优化:
- 压缩HTML、CSS和JavaScript文件,减少文件大小。
- 移除不必要的代码,如注释、空格和多余的标签。
- 使用压缩工具,如Gzip或Brotli进行服务器端压缩。
四、图片优化
1、选择合适的图片格式:如JPEG、PNG或WebP,根据图片内容和用途选择最合适的格式。
2、压缩图片:使用图片压缩工具,如TinyPNG或ImageOptim,在不影响质量的情况下减小图片文件大小。
3、使用图片CDN:通过CDN分发图片,减少图片加载时间。

五、缓存策略
1、启用浏览器缓存:设置合理的缓存策略,让用户在下次访问时能够快速加载页面。
2、使用CDN缓存:利用CDN的缓存功能,加速静态资源的加载。
3、服务器缓存:配置服务器缓存,减少对数据库的查询次数,提高响应速度。
六、数据库优化
1、索引优化:对数据库表进行索引优化,提高查询效率。
2、数据库分库分表:对于大型网站,可以考虑数据库分库分表,减轻数据库压力。
3、缓存数据库查询结果:对于频繁查询的数据,可以使用缓存技术,如Redis或Memcached。
七、监控与评估
1、使用性能监控工具:如Google PageSpeed Insights、Lighthouse等,定期检查网站性能。
2、分析性能数据:根据监控数据,分析性能瓶颈,持续优化。
3、用户反馈:收集用户反馈,了解网站性能对用户体验的影响。
八、ZhukunSEO总结
网站性能优化是一个持续的过程,需要不断调整和优化。通过上述方案的实施,可以有效提升网站性能,为用户提供更好的体验。